[DAGCombiner] Avoid double deletion when replacing multiple frozen/unfrozen uses (#155427) Closes https://github.com/llvm/llvm-project/issues/155345. In the original case, we have one frozen use and two unfrozen uses: ``` t73: i8 = select t81, Constant:i8<0>, t18 t75: i8 = select t10, t18, t73 t59: i8 = freeze t18 (combining) t80: i8 = freeze t59 (another user of t59) ``` In `DAGCombiner::visitFREEZE`, we replace all uses of `t18` with `t59`. After updating the uses, `t59: i8 = freeze t18` will be updated to `t59: i8 = freeze t59` (`AddModifiedNodeToCSEMaps`) and CSEed into `t80: i8 = freeze t59` (`ReplaceAllUsesWith`). As the previous call to `AddModifiedNodeToCSEMaps` already removed `t59` from the CSE map, `ReplaceAllUsesWith` cannot remove `t59` again. For clarity, see the following call graph: ``` ReplaceAllUsesOfValueWith(t18, t59) ReplaceAllUsesWith(t18, t59) RemoveNodeFromCSEMaps(t73) update t73 AddModifiedNodeToCSEMaps(t73) RemoveNodeFromCSEMaps(t75) update t75 AddModifiedNodeToCSEMaps(t75) RemoveNodeFromCSEMaps(t59) <- first delection update t59 AddModifiedNodeToCSEMaps(t59) ReplaceAllUsesWith(t59, t80) RemoveNodeFromCSEMaps(t59) <- second delection Boom! ``` This patch unfreezes all the uses first to avoid triggering CSE when introducing cycles.
